Installation Manual 4.6 Connection of digital inputs DI1 to DI14 The SMX has 14 secure digital inputs These are suitable for connecting single or twochannel signals with and without cycling, or without cross-shorting test. The connected signals must have a "High"-level of DC 24 V (DC +15 V...+ DC 30 V ) and a "Low"-level of (DC -3 V...DC +5 V, type 1 acc. to EN61131-2). The inputs are provided with internal input filters. A device internal diagnostic function cyclically tests the correct function of the inputs including the input filters. A detected fault will set the SMX into an alarm status. At the same time all outputs of the SMX are rendered passive. Besides the actual signal inputs DI1 to DI14 the SMX module holds two clock inputs P1 and P2 available. The clock outputs are switching-type 24 VDC outputs. The clock outputs are solely intended for monitoring the digital inputs (DI1 ... DI14) and cannot be used for any other function within the application. The switching frequency is 125 Hz for each output. In the planning stage one must bear in mind that the outputs may only be loaded with a total current of max. 250 mA. Furthermore, approved OSSD-outputs can be connected to the inputs DI1-DI4 and DI9-DI14 without limitation Note: Digital inputs DI5 to DI8 are not suitable for OSSDs, because there is no compliance with EN 61131-2 Type 2 requirements. Short circuits in the external wiring between different inputs and against the supply voltage for the SMX must be ruled out by external measures, appropriate routing of cables in particular. Each input of the SMX module can be configured individually for the following signal sources: Input assigned to pulse P1 Input assigned to pulse P2 Input assigned to continuous voltage DC 24 V The internal structure of the SMX-series corresponds with category 4 of EN 13849-1 with respect to architecture and function.
